Sticky Japanese Beef And Noodles In Ginger Broth Recipe


Ready in 30 minutes, this quick and easy Asian noodle soup is just the thing to warm you up on a chilly winters night.

The ingredient of Sticky Japanese Beef And Noodles In Ginger Broth Recipe

  • 7cm piece fresh ginger peeled
  • 1 tablespoon peanut oil
  • 500g beef mince
  • 2 garlic cloves crushed
  • 1 2 cup mirin seasoning
  • 1 tablespoon brown sugar
  • 1 2 cup light soy sauce
  • 1 5 litres massel salt reduced chicken style liquid stock
  • 270g packet hakubaku organic soba noodles
  • 3 baby buk choy halved lengthways
  • 50g snow peas thinly sliced lengthways
  • 2 green onions thinly sliced diagonally
  • 3 soft boiled eggs peeled halved to serve
  • 1 4 teaspoon shichimi togarashi 7 spice mix to serve

The Instruction of sticky japanese beef and noodles in ginger broth recipe

  • finely grate 3cm ginger heat oil in a large non stick frying pan over high heat add mince cook breaking up mince with a wooden spoon for 4 to 5 minutes or until well browned add garlic and grated ginger cook stirring for 1 minute or until fragrant add combined mirin sugar and half the soy sauce cook stirring over medium heat for 2 minutes or liquid is reduced and mixture is sticky remove frying pan from heat
  • meanwhile thinly slice remaining ginger combine stock sliced ginger and remaining soy in a medium saucepan bring to the boil
  • cook soba noodles following packet directions drain
  • divide noodles buk choy and snow peas among serving bowls pour over hot broth top with mince mixture onion egg and shichimi togarashi serve
